Weekly real estate market update 5/27/22… number of price drops continues to increase

Weekly Market Stats 2022-05-27

As expected at the beginning of this holiday weekend, new listings dropped, coming close to the number of pending listings, and coming soon listings increased. Price drops continued to increase, it will bear looking into how those price drops are influencing pricing on new listings.

YTD Market Stats-2022-5-27

The last three years of showings appear to be converging as we approach the holiday weekend when showings can be expected to drop.
